Home-brew it your
way
Shop sells all you'll need for fun,
flavorful hobby
By Kristen Cook ARIZONA DAILY STAR
BYOB doesn't mean the usual at Gary Wilder's
store. Instead of "Bring Your Own Bottle," it stands for for Brew Your Own
Brew, the name of his shop. No matter what your poison - from suds to soda -
Wilder sells the home-brewing supplies to make it yourself. And believe it
or not, Wilder says home brewing isn't that hard. "If you can boil water for
60 minutes, you can make beer," Wilder said. The sweet, subtly spicy smell
of root beer permeates his small store. A giant refrigerator houses
different hops and yeast strains as well as soda extracts like cola and
cherry. Stainless steel shelves are lined with dozens of different beer
kits, cheese-making kits and fruit bases to make sweet wines. You can also
find beer-bread mixes and sourdough starters, along with conversion kits to
turn a refrigerator into a "keggerator." Yup, that's right - a keggerator.
Wilder opened Brew Your Own Brew in 1996 after the heavy-equipment plant he
worked for closed. A home brewer for years, he decided to turn his hobby
into a profession. Along the way, he's converted many people from canned
beer. "We've got customers who say, 'This (home-brew) is so good, I'm never
going back to commercial beer,' '' said Wilder, whose own beer and prickly
pear wine have won several awards.
"You can make them
as strong or as light as you want." Brew Your Own Brew offers basic kits
that are as simple as cake mixes, as well as more advanced ones. "You can
even make your own malt extract, but that's an all-day process," said
Wilder, a bona fide brewer with a certificate from the American Brewers
Guild. Many parents who are interested in brewing buy the soda-making stuff
so they can share their hobby with their kids, he said. "(Home brewing) is
the fastest-growing hobby in America," said Wilder, who averages two new
customers a day. Count William Steudler among those who have recently
discovered the joy of brewing. The engineer started with a "cheapo Mr. Beer
kit," a Christmas gift from his mother. Now his beers and meads are winning
medals in national competitions. "Being an engineer, I try to engineer the
perfect beer," he said. "That's my quest." And one that takes a lot of sudsy
supplies. A loyal customer for two years, Steudler said he visits Brew Your
Own Brew at least once a week and has his friends hooked on his home-brew.
"It's a lot of fun," he said. "It's a fun hobby." Kristen Cook can be
